One of the standout advantages of choosing a granny flat accommodation in Sankt Moritz or nearby towns is the added privacy and kitchen facilities. A granny flat is typically a self-contained unit on the same property as the host’s home, offering a private entrance, a kitchen or kitchenette, and a flexible floor plan that’s ideal for families or friend groups traveling together. This setup keeps everyone close enough for shared meals and festive evenings, while giving you the freedom to come and go on your own schedule. Destinations and neighborhoods to consider within the Maloja District

The Maloja District encompasses a cluster of towns and villages around Sankt Moritz that are ideal for family outings, scenic drives, and easy day trips. Consider these bases and experiences when planning your stay:

  • Sankt Moritz Dorf and St. Moritz Bad: The heart of the resort experience, with luxury shopping, cozy cafés, and easy access to the surrounding slopes and lakefront paths. For families, it’s a hub of gentle activities, kid-friendly eateries, and gentle strolls along the lake in the evenings.
  • Surlej and Corviglia area: A short ride from the village center, Surlej offers convenient access to gondolas and easier lift lines—great for families who want to maximize skiing time without long daily commutes.
  • Silvaplana and Sils im Engadin: Known for wind sports on the lake and a relaxed village atmosphere, these towns provide a balance of outdoor adventure and calm alpine vibes, plus varied dining options and charming granny flats near the lake.
  • Celerina and nearby hamlets: A tranquil base for families who want a more laid-back pace, with direct access to valley trails and cross-country routes that showcase the Engadin’s expansive network of winter and summer paths.

Cultural and local experiences

Beyond the athletic approach, the Maloja District offers authentic experiences that enrich a family vacation. Expect traditional Engadin houses with hand-painted facades, seasonal markets selling local cheese and bread, and opportunities to learn about Swiss Alpine farming, crafts, and music.
